Job description for Strategy Analyst Intern at Carsome Singapore
Responsibilities
About You
You will be part of Strategy & Corporate Development team where you will be responsible for providing relevant insights to help the company address key business challenges, identify avenues for scale and optimize existing processes. You will do this by conducting detailed internal/external research, gathering relevant external/internal data points and laying out the foundations of a robust company strategy. The role will include developing new business models, pricing strategies, identifying new growth initiatives, and advising HODs while tracking and analyzing business OKRs to meet company objectives.
Your Day-to-Day
• Gather, interpret data, analyze results using analytics, research methodologies, and statistical techniques.
• Execute and deliver on key analysis/recommendations on strategic projects, including multiple types of market analysis, competitive analysis, internal financial analysis, financial modelling, and scenario planning as inputs for company strategy.
• Conduct full lifecycle of industry/market research, including pulling, manipulating, and exporting data from a variety of sources.
• Maintain and update strategic scorecard and other tools to assess and drive high-quality execution of our regional strategy.
• Act as a liaison between different teams/stakeholders both internal and external to drive efficiency and implement processes.
• Prepare, analyze, and summarize various monthly, and periodic results for use by various key stakeholders, creating reports, specifications, instructions, and flowcharts.
